Arborist Tree Service in Reno, NV
Arborist tree services encompass a range of professional practices aimed at maintaining, removing, and caring for trees on residential properties. These services often include pruning to promote healthy growth, trimming to improve appearance and safety, and tree removal when a tree poses a risk or is no longer viable. Property owners typically seek arborist services to enhance the safety of their landscape, prevent damage from falling branches or trees, and ensure the health and longevity of their trees through proper care and maintenance.
Before requesting arborist services, homeowners should consider the specific needs of their trees and property. This includes understanding the scope of work required, such as whether a tree needs pruning, crown thinning, or complete removal. It is also helpful to evaluate the condition of the trees, identify any signs of disease or decay, and determine the desired outcome for the landscape. Clear communication about these factors can help ensure the appropriate services are provided to meet both safety and aesthetic goals.

Common Arborist Tree Service Jobs
Tree pruning - shaping trees to maintain health and appearance.
Tree removal - safely removing dead, diseased, or hazardous trees.
Emergency storm response - clearing fallen limbs and storm-damaged trees.
Cabling and bracing - supporting weak branches to prevent breakage.
Stump grinding - removing tree stumps to improve yard safety and aesthetics.
Tree health assessments - evaluating trees for disease or structural issues.
Arborist Tree Service Questions
What types of trees are suitable for pruning? Trees that show dead, damaged, or overgrown branches typically benefit from pruning to promote healthy growth and safety.
How often should tree trimming be done? Regular trimming is recommended every 1 to 3 years, depending on the tree species and growth rate.
When is the best time for tree removal? The ideal time for removal is during dormancy, usually late winter or early spring, to minimize stress on the tree.
What signs indicate a tree needs to be inspected? Signs include leaning, cracked or broken branches, fungal growth, or roots lifting from the ground.
